Understanding the Basics of Plinko

At its heart, plinko is a vertical board adorned with rows of pegs. Players begin by placing a bet and selecting a color or a specific slot at the bottom of the board. A puck or ball is then released from the top, cascading down the board and randomly bouncing off the pegs. Each peg directs the puck either left or right, and this continues until it reaches the bottom, landing in one of the designated slots.

The payout associated with each slot varies, typically offering different multipliers based on its position. Slots located in the center generally offer higher payouts but are less frequently hit, while those on the sides provide smaller, more consistent rewards. The randomness of the bouncing process guarantees that each game is unique and unpredictable, making it a truly captivating experience for players of all levels. Understanding these fundamentals is key to appreciating the simplicity and excitement of plinko.

Responsible Gaming and Setting Limits

While plinko can be a thoroughly enjoyable and entertaining game, it is crucial to approach it with a responsible mindset. Like any form of gambling, there is always a risk of losing money, and it is essential to set limits and stick to them. A fundamental rule is to only gamble with money you can afford to lose, and never chase losses in an attempt to recoup them.

Setting a budget before you start playing is a wise decision, and it’s equally important to stick to that budget. Consider setting both a win limit and a loss limit; when either is reached, stop playing. Remember that plinko is ultimately a game of chance. There is no guaranteed way to win, and it’s important to avoid any strategies or systems that promise guaranteed profits.
